Remedy for unpleasant odor from pipes

To help you overcome the battle against unpleasant odors coming from your sink or drain, try using the following mixture.

To prepare it, mix equal parts baking soda and white vinegar. Pour this mixture down the drain and add hot water on top – as a result, you will dissolve the grease and get rid of the stench.

There is another method that requires boiling water in a saucepan with a few pieces of lemon or orange peel and pouring this concoction down the drain (after it has cooled down a bit).

This product also neutralizes dirt and effectively combats odors.

Last but not least on the list is a mixture of equal parts baking soda, lemon juice (or vinegar) and salt. Like the others, it works great to remove clogs and stench.
